Scotland 2010 Tour Dates Announced
Scotland will tour Argentina and play two Test matches in the summer of 2010, it was confirmed today. Scotland, who won their last match in Argentina in 2008 and who lost narrowly in a closely-fought encounter at Murrayfield last month, open their tour on Saturday 12 June in Tucuman. The second Test will be played in Mar Del Plata on Saturday 19 June. Kick-off times for both Test matches are still being finalised. Argentina are in Scotland’s pool for the 2011 Rugby World Cup in New Zealand.
